For all you people trying to sell your domain names, how exactly do you put a value on it? Is there a standard that you go by?

You have to consider the power of it to both search engines and marketers, something like dirt.com would be no good for someone trying to get search engine rankings for keywords like makingmoney.com would, but would be great for a washing machine company because they could use it in there adverts and people would be able to remember it.

So to answer your question, I think it would come down to luck if you auctioned it, you would be lucky if someone/people saw the hidden potential from a marketing point of view. You could also be lucky if top players from some sort of online marketing niche saw it and wanted to develop on it.

Thats how I see domain name value.
